9. Consumer Rights
Under the Consumer Rights Act 2015, you have certain statutory rights including:
- Services must be performed with reasonable care and skill
- Materials supplied must be of satisfactory quality
- Work must be completed within a reasonable time if no time is agreed
- You have remedies if services are not provided as described
These terms do not affect your statutory rights as a consumer.
